Kurt Newman wrote: > I have no intention of writing derivation work, but I guess to > technically obide by these rules, I wouldn't be able to provide a binary > rpm with my software because of a newer libc errno patch that must be > applied before compilation (url: > http://moni.csi.hu/pub/glibc-2.3.1/daemontools-0.76.errno.patch). > AFAIK, The code compile cleanly if you use dietlibc. You could build a RPM without the patch that way. If you want to know how to do, I think the Mandrake Qmail SRPMS have an option to compile with dietlibc. You will find the Mandrake SRPM daemon tools there too: ftp://ftp.ibiblio.org/pub/packages/rpmhelp/Mandrake/djbware/9.1/SRPMS/daemontools-0.76-6rph.src.rpm with the errno patch.
